(a) A person, whose tender or offer for grant of a lease on payment of premium is accepted, shall pay half of such premium within fifteen days of the acceptance of his offer and the balance within one month thereafter. The Chief Executive Officer, may, in his absolute discretion, grant extension of time for payment of the balance premium upto a maximum of six months of the date of acceptance on payment of interest for the extended period at the rate of 12 per cent. per annum or at such other higher rate as may be determined by the authority from time to time.
(b) Whenever a lease shall be granted in consideration of premium, the ground rent shall be payable annually in advance without any deductions whatsoever, on or before the 10th day of January in each and every year, at the rates to be determined by the Authority from time to time.
[10. Execution of, lease deed and delivery of possession of land. - After payment of the whole amount of premium, there shall be executed a lease deed, in favour of allottee, subject to the directions, if any, to the contrary by the Authority in any case having regard to the facts and circumstances thereof, the possession of the land shall not be delivered before execution of such lease deed.]
